mhtml文件 excel
作者:百问excel教程网
|
139人看过
发布时间:2026-01-19 08:01:06
标签:
m 文件与 Excel 的关系解析:数据格式与应用实践在数据处理与文件格式的领域中,m 文件与 Excel 文件的结合使用,既体现了数据存储的灵活性,也展示了不同格式之间的兼容性。本文将从技术原理、使用场景、操作方法以
m 文件与 Excel 的关系解析:数据格式与应用实践
在数据处理与文件格式的领域中,m 文件与 Excel 文件的结合使用,既体现了数据存储的灵活性,也展示了不同格式之间的兼容性。本文将从技术原理、使用场景、操作方法以及实际应用等方面,系统分析 m 文件与 Excel 文件的关系,并提供实用的操作建议。
一、m 文件的基本概念
m 是一种网页文件格式,全称是 MIME HTML,它用于将 HTML 页面与资源(如图片、样式表等)打包成一个单一的文件。这种格式在早期的网页开发中被广泛使用,尤其是在浏览器中加载网页时,m 文件可以作为独立的文件被下载和打开。
m 文件的结构通常是基于 HTML 标签的,同时包含嵌入的资源,如图片、CSS、JavaScript 等。由于其结构紧凑,m 文件在某些情况下可以被直接用于数据处理,尤其是当需要将网页内容转换为结构化数据时。
二、Excel 文件的基本概念
Excel 是微软开发的一种电子表格软件,主要用于数据的存储、计算和分析。Excel 文件的扩展名通常是 `.xlsx` 或 `.xls`,它基于二进制格式,能够支持大量的数据记录,且具备强大的数据处理功能,如公式、图表、数据透视表等。
Excel 文件的结构由多个工作表组成,每个工作表由行和列构成,数据以表格形式存储。Excel 文件的灵活性和强大的数据处理能力,使其成为数据管理、报表生成和数据分析的首选工具。
三、m 文件与 Excel 文件的关系
1. 数据格式的兼容性
m 文件本质上是一种网页格式,而 Excel 文件是一种电子表格格式。两者在数据格式上存在一定的兼容性,尤其是在处理网页内容时,m 文件可以被解析为 HTML 格式,而 Excel 文件则可以读取其中的文本内容。
在一些情况下,m 文件可以被转换为 Excel 文件,例如将网页中的表格数据转换为 Excel 表格。这种转换可以通过编程手段,如使用 Python 的 `pandas` 或 `openpyxl` 库实现,也可以通过某些工具自动完成。
2. 数据处理中的应用
在数据处理过程中,m 文件和 Excel 文件可以结合使用,发挥各自的优势。例如,m 文件可以用于存储网页内容,而 Excel 文件用于对数据进行分析和处理。这种组合可以提高数据处理的效率,减少数据转换的复杂性。
同时,m 文件也可以被用于数据可视化,例如将网页中的表格数据导出为 Excel 文件,以便进一步分析和展示。
3. 文件格式的转换
m 文件与 Excel 文件之间的转换,通常需要借助第三方工具或编程手段。例如,使用 Python 的 `pyexcel` 库,可以将 m 文件中的 HTML 内容解析为 Excel 格式。这一过程需要对 HTML 内容进行解析,提取数据,并按照 Excel 的格式进行存储。
在实际操作中,需要注意以下几点:
- m 文件中的 HTML 内容可能包含多个表格,需要逐一解析。
- 在转换过程中,需要确保提取的数据格式与 Excel 文件的要求一致。
- 转换后的 Excel 文件需要进行验证,确保数据的完整性。
四、m 文件与 Excel 文件的使用场景
1. 网页数据的提取与处理
在网页开发和数据抓取中,m 文件可以作为数据源,用于提取网页中的表格、图片、文本等信息。例如,使用 Python 的 `requests` 和 `BeautifulSoup` 库,可以将 m 文件中的 HTML 内容解析为结构化的数据,然后导入 Excel 文件进行进一步处理。
2. 数据分析与报表生成
Excel 文件在数据处理和报表生成中具有不可替代的作用。m 文件中的网页数据可以被导入 Excel 文件,用于进行数据清洗、统计分析、图表生成等操作。这种方式可以提高数据处理的效率,减少人工操作的负担。
3. 网页内容的导出与共享
m 文件可以用于存储网页内容,例如将一个网页的结构和数据保存为 m 文件,然后通过 Excel 文件进行导出和共享。这种方式适用于需要将网页内容以结构化数据形式分享给他人,或进行进一步的分析。
五、m 文件与 Excel 文件的操作方法
1. 将 m 文件转换为 Excel 文件
将 m 文件转换为 Excel 文件,可以通过以下步骤实现:
1. 使用 Python 的 `pyexcel` 库解析 m 文件。
2. 提取 m 文件中的 HTML 内容。
3. 将提取的数据按照 Excel 的格式进行存储。
4. 生成 Excel 文件。
示例代码如下:
python
from pyexcel import write_sheet
import requests
from bs4 import BeautifulSoup
1. 获取 m 文件内容
url = "https://example.com/data."
response = requests.get(url)
_content = response.text
2. 解析 HTML 内容
soup = BeautifulSoup(_content, ".parser")
tables = soup.find_all("table")
3. 将表格数据写入 Excel 文件
write_sheet(data=tables, path="output.xlsx")
2. 将 Excel 文件导入 m 文件
将 Excel 文件导入 m 文件,可以通过以下步骤实现:
1. 将 Excel 文件中的数据导出为 HTML 格式。
2. 将导出的 HTML 文件保存为 m 文件。
3. 在网页中加载该 m 文件,即可查看数据内容。
六、m 文件与 Excel 文件的注意事项
1. 数据格式的准确性
在转换和导出过程中,需要确保提取的数据格式与 Excel 文件的要求一致,否则可能导致数据不完整或格式错误。
2. 文件的兼容性
不同版本的 Excel 文件可能在格式上存在差异,因此在转换和导入过程中,需要确保文件的兼容性。
3. 数据安全与隐私
在处理网页数据时,需要注意数据的安全性和隐私保护,避免敏感信息被泄露。
七、总结
m 文件与 Excel 文件在数据处理和文件格式转换中具有重要地位。m 文件可以用于存储网页内容,而 Excel 文件则可以用于数据的结构化处理和分析。两者之间的结合使用,可以提高数据处理的效率,同时满足多样化的数据管理需求。
在实际操作中,需要注意数据的格式转换、文件的兼容性以及数据的安全性。通过合理使用 m 文件与 Excel 文件,可以实现更高效的数据管理和分析,提升工作效率。
八、
在数据处理的实践中,m 文件与 Excel 文件的结合使用,为数据的存储、转换和分析提供了灵活的解决方案。通过合理利用这两种文件格式,可以更好地满足不同场景下的数据管理需求,提升整体的数据处理效率。
无论是网页数据的提取,还是数据分析与报表生成,m 文件与 Excel 文件的结合,都展现出了强大的实用价值。希望本文能为读者提供有价值的参考,帮助他们在实际工作中更高效地处理数据。
在数据处理与文件格式的领域中,m 文件与 Excel 文件的结合使用,既体现了数据存储的灵活性,也展示了不同格式之间的兼容性。本文将从技术原理、使用场景、操作方法以及实际应用等方面,系统分析 m 文件与 Excel 文件的关系,并提供实用的操作建议。
一、m 文件的基本概念
m 是一种网页文件格式,全称是 MIME HTML,它用于将 HTML 页面与资源(如图片、样式表等)打包成一个单一的文件。这种格式在早期的网页开发中被广泛使用,尤其是在浏览器中加载网页时,m 文件可以作为独立的文件被下载和打开。
m 文件的结构通常是基于 HTML 标签的,同时包含嵌入的资源,如图片、CSS、JavaScript 等。由于其结构紧凑,m 文件在某些情况下可以被直接用于数据处理,尤其是当需要将网页内容转换为结构化数据时。
二、Excel 文件的基本概念
Excel 是微软开发的一种电子表格软件,主要用于数据的存储、计算和分析。Excel 文件的扩展名通常是 `.xlsx` 或 `.xls`,它基于二进制格式,能够支持大量的数据记录,且具备强大的数据处理功能,如公式、图表、数据透视表等。
Excel 文件的结构由多个工作表组成,每个工作表由行和列构成,数据以表格形式存储。Excel 文件的灵活性和强大的数据处理能力,使其成为数据管理、报表生成和数据分析的首选工具。
三、m 文件与 Excel 文件的关系
1. 数据格式的兼容性
m 文件本质上是一种网页格式,而 Excel 文件是一种电子表格格式。两者在数据格式上存在一定的兼容性,尤其是在处理网页内容时,m 文件可以被解析为 HTML 格式,而 Excel 文件则可以读取其中的文本内容。
在一些情况下,m 文件可以被转换为 Excel 文件,例如将网页中的表格数据转换为 Excel 表格。这种转换可以通过编程手段,如使用 Python 的 `pandas` 或 `openpyxl` 库实现,也可以通过某些工具自动完成。
2. 数据处理中的应用
在数据处理过程中,m 文件和 Excel 文件可以结合使用,发挥各自的优势。例如,m 文件可以用于存储网页内容,而 Excel 文件用于对数据进行分析和处理。这种组合可以提高数据处理的效率,减少数据转换的复杂性。
同时,m 文件也可以被用于数据可视化,例如将网页中的表格数据导出为 Excel 文件,以便进一步分析和展示。
3. 文件格式的转换
m 文件与 Excel 文件之间的转换,通常需要借助第三方工具或编程手段。例如,使用 Python 的 `pyexcel` 库,可以将 m 文件中的 HTML 内容解析为 Excel 格式。这一过程需要对 HTML 内容进行解析,提取数据,并按照 Excel 的格式进行存储。
在实际操作中,需要注意以下几点:
- m 文件中的 HTML 内容可能包含多个表格,需要逐一解析。
- 在转换过程中,需要确保提取的数据格式与 Excel 文件的要求一致。
- 转换后的 Excel 文件需要进行验证,确保数据的完整性。
四、m 文件与 Excel 文件的使用场景
1. 网页数据的提取与处理
在网页开发和数据抓取中,m 文件可以作为数据源,用于提取网页中的表格、图片、文本等信息。例如,使用 Python 的 `requests` 和 `BeautifulSoup` 库,可以将 m 文件中的 HTML 内容解析为结构化的数据,然后导入 Excel 文件进行进一步处理。
2. 数据分析与报表生成
Excel 文件在数据处理和报表生成中具有不可替代的作用。m 文件中的网页数据可以被导入 Excel 文件,用于进行数据清洗、统计分析、图表生成等操作。这种方式可以提高数据处理的效率,减少人工操作的负担。
3. 网页内容的导出与共享
m 文件可以用于存储网页内容,例如将一个网页的结构和数据保存为 m 文件,然后通过 Excel 文件进行导出和共享。这种方式适用于需要将网页内容以结构化数据形式分享给他人,或进行进一步的分析。
五、m 文件与 Excel 文件的操作方法
1. 将 m 文件转换为 Excel 文件
将 m 文件转换为 Excel 文件,可以通过以下步骤实现:
1. 使用 Python 的 `pyexcel` 库解析 m 文件。
2. 提取 m 文件中的 HTML 内容。
3. 将提取的数据按照 Excel 的格式进行存储。
4. 生成 Excel 文件。
示例代码如下:
python
from pyexcel import write_sheet
import requests
from bs4 import BeautifulSoup
1. 获取 m 文件内容
url = "https://example.com/data."
response = requests.get(url)
_content = response.text
2. 解析 HTML 内容
soup = BeautifulSoup(_content, ".parser")
tables = soup.find_all("table")
3. 将表格数据写入 Excel 文件
write_sheet(data=tables, path="output.xlsx")
2. 将 Excel 文件导入 m 文件
将 Excel 文件导入 m 文件,可以通过以下步骤实现:
1. 将 Excel 文件中的数据导出为 HTML 格式。
2. 将导出的 HTML 文件保存为 m 文件。
3. 在网页中加载该 m 文件,即可查看数据内容。
六、m 文件与 Excel 文件的注意事项
1. 数据格式的准确性
在转换和导出过程中,需要确保提取的数据格式与 Excel 文件的要求一致,否则可能导致数据不完整或格式错误。
2. 文件的兼容性
不同版本的 Excel 文件可能在格式上存在差异,因此在转换和导入过程中,需要确保文件的兼容性。
3. 数据安全与隐私
在处理网页数据时,需要注意数据的安全性和隐私保护,避免敏感信息被泄露。
七、总结
m 文件与 Excel 文件在数据处理和文件格式转换中具有重要地位。m 文件可以用于存储网页内容,而 Excel 文件则可以用于数据的结构化处理和分析。两者之间的结合使用,可以提高数据处理的效率,同时满足多样化的数据管理需求。
在实际操作中,需要注意数据的格式转换、文件的兼容性以及数据的安全性。通过合理使用 m 文件与 Excel 文件,可以实现更高效的数据管理和分析,提升工作效率。
八、
在数据处理的实践中,m 文件与 Excel 文件的结合使用,为数据的存储、转换和分析提供了灵活的解决方案。通过合理利用这两种文件格式,可以更好地满足不同场景下的数据管理需求,提升整体的数据处理效率。
无论是网页数据的提取,还是数据分析与报表生成,m 文件与 Excel 文件的结合,都展现出了强大的实用价值。希望本文能为读者提供有价值的参考,帮助他们在实际工作中更高效地处理数据。
推荐文章
解锁Excel密码:从安全到破解的全面指南在数据驱动的时代,Excel已成为企业与个人日常工作中不可或缺的工具。然而,随着数据的日益复杂,Excel文件的安全性问题也逐渐凸显。对于用户而言,理解Excel密码的含义与作用,不仅有助于保
2026-01-19 08:01:03
342人看过
如何把 Excel 转成 CSV?深度实用指南在数据处理和文件转换的过程中,Excel 和 CSV 是两种常见格式,它们各有特点。Excel 是微软开发的电子表格软件,支持丰富的数据格式和操作功能,而 CSV(Comma-Separa
2026-01-19 08:00:57
317人看过
读取Excel文件内容为DataURL的实用方法与技术解析在现代数据处理与网页开发中,读取Excel文件并将其内容以`data URL`形式展示是一种常见需求。`data URL`是一种将文件内容嵌入到HTML中的方式,可以实现文件的
2026-01-19 07:58:32
314人看过
介绍在现代数据处理与分析中,Excel 是一个广泛使用的工具,它能够帮助用户快速地整理数据、进行分析和生成报表。然而,当数据量较大时,手动导出 Excel 文件变得非常繁琐,也容易出错。因此,开发能够将数据导出为 Excel 文件的功
2026-01-19 07:57:56
265人看过
.webp)
.webp)
.webp)
.webp)